出租车计费系统

出租车计费系统

ID:79124374

大小:309.97 KB

页数:30页

时间:2022-02-09

出租车计费系统_第1页
出租车计费系统_第2页
出租车计费系统_第3页
出租车计费系统_第4页
出租车计费系统_第5页
出租车计费系统_第6页
出租车计费系统_第7页
出租车计费系统_第8页
出租车计费系统_第9页
出租车计费系统_第10页
资源描述:

《出租车计费系统》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、课程设计报告项目名称:出租车计价器设计与制作课程名称:单片机技术二级学院:电气与电子工程学院系:电气工程系班级:14电气4班学号:_^9学生姓名:黄凌周小组成员:刘智超黄凌周指导教师:钟立华报告完成日期2016年12月20日目录摘要3..1课程设计任务书.4.1.1课程设计任务4.1.2课程设计方案4.2硬件电路设计52.1振荡电路5.2.2复位电路设计6.2.3键盘接口电路6.2.4显示电路6.2.4.11602LCD的基本参数及引脚功能62.4.2显示模块采用1602液晶显示接口电路82.5单片机各引脚功能说

2、明.8.3软件设计103.1单片机资源使用103.2单片机软件模块设计113.2.1中断子函数113.2.2判键子函数1.13.2.3显示子程序123.3总程序流程框图14总结1.5参考文献16附录1元件件清单1.7附录2原理图1..8.附录3程序清单1..9.本设计的是一个基于单片机STC89C52的出租车自动计费设计,附有复位电路,时钟电路,键盘电路等。复位电路是单片机的初始化操作,除了正常的初始化外,为摆脱困境,通过复位电路可以重新开始。时钟电路采用12MHz勺晶振,作为系统的时钟源,具有较高的准确性。在上

3、电时字符型液晶1602S示最初的起步价,里程收费,等待时间收费三种收费,通过按键可以调整起步价,里程收费,等待时间收费。通过按键模拟出租车的运行,暂停,停止。在1602液晶上可以显示运行的时间,运行时暂停的时间,通过计算可以得出总共的费用和总的路程。在这里主要是以STC89C52片机为核心控制器,P1口接1602液晶显示模块。关键字STC89C521602M晶;出租车计费器1课程设计任务书1.1课程设计任务基于单片机出租车模拟计价器,采用at24c02存储芯片+LCD1602M晶显示等设计而成。用24c02来存储

4、单价,通过按键来模拟增加里程,模拟出租车向前开。通过液晶显示器显示当前的行驶状态、行驶公里、行驶时间时间(时、分、秒)、费用、单价、等信息。可以设置每公里单价,以及夜间单价和白天单价的不同模式,设置后掉电无需重新设置,设置有等待/继续计时模式。计费分行走的里程单价+等待的时间价格。1.2课程设计方案方案一:采用数字电子技术,利用555定时芯片构成多谐振荡器,或采用外围的晶振电路作为时钟脉冲信号,采用计数芯片对脉冲尽心脉冲的计数和分频,最后通过译码电路对数据进行译码,将译码所得的数据送给数码管显示,一下是该方案的流

5、程框图,方案一如图1.1所示:图1.1方案一数码管显示图2.1振荡电路图2.1振荡电路方案二:采用ED徽术,根据层次化设计理论,该设计问题自顶向下可分为分频模块,控制模块计量模块、译码和动态扫描显示模块,具系统框图如图1.2所示:显示图2.1振荡电路方案三:采用MC我术,通过单片机作为主控器,利用1602字符液晶作为显示电路,采用外部晶振作为时钟脉冲,通过按键可以方便调节,以下是方案三的系统流程图,本方案主要是必须对于数字电路比较熟悉,成本又高。方案图如图1.3所示:图2.1振荡电路图2.1振荡电路图1.3方案三

6、不但控制简单,而且成本方案总结:通过各个方案的比较本次采用方案三,低廉,设计电路简单。2硬件电路设计2.1振荡电路单片机内部有一个高增益、反相放大器,其输入端为芯片引脚XTAL1,其输出端为引脚XTAL2通过这两个引脚在芯片外并接石英晶体振荡器和两只电容(电容和一般取20pF)。这样就构成一个稳定的自激振荡器。振荡电路脉冲经过二分频后作为系统的时钟信号,再在二分频的基础上三分频产生ALE信号,此时得到的信号时机器周期信号。振荡电路如图2.1所示:图2.1振荡电路图2.1振荡电路2.1复位电路设计复位操作有两种基本

7、形式:一种是上电复位,另一种是按键复位。按键复位具有上电复位功能外,若要复位,只要按图中的RESET®,电源VCCS电阻R1、R2分压,在RESE,产生一个复位高电平。上电复位电路要求接通电源后,通过外部电容充电来实现单片机自动复位操作。上电瞬间RESEEI脚获得高电平,随着电容的充电,RERS引脚的高电平将逐渐下降。RERSE唧的高电平只要能保持足够的时间(2个机器周期),单片机就可以进行复位操作。按键复位电路图如图2.2所示。图2.2复位电路2.2键盘接口电路(1)独立式键盘:独立式键盘中,每个按键占用一根I

8、/O口线,每个按键电路相对独立。I/O□通过按键与地相连,I/O□有上拉电阻,无键按下时,引脚端为高电平,有键按下时,引脚电平被拉低。I/O□内部有上拉电阻时,外部可不接上拉电阻。键盘接口电路如图2.3所示:1mI0IoI0I0I0I「」」」〕2.1显示电路2.1.11602LCD的基本参数及引脚功能1602LC防为带背光和不带背光两种,基控制器大部分为HD44780带背

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。